12. Programming via Shareport

In order to ease customisation of the Xerox FS 5250, FSL parame ters for twinax input can be programmed directly via the interface's Centronics or serial (RS-232) port using the Engineering Function Y249.

The Engineering Function enables the system to detect whether FSL sequences on shareport are intended for twinax FSL input or for shareport setup and will direct the sequences received to the twinax FSL interpreter.

The sequence works as a switch for FSL sequences. The defined Escape Character will also be translated and defined as Escape Character for the twinax FSL module. The ability to set up via the shareport is reset after timeout on the shareport and can not be saved in the NVRAM 10.

The setup sequence must only contain ASCII characters. Apostrophe notation can be used if characters are included in the US ASCII 7 bit character set, all other data must be in HEX notation.

All functions which are accessible from the twinax input can be used via Centronics/RS-232 setup.

12.1. Activating the Y249 Engineering Function

Before the Engineering Function can be activated, an Escape character must be defined:

&&??<character>

The sequence "&&??%" will define "%" as the ESC Character.
